The Wisconsin Journal of Law, Gender & Society has named law student Marisol Gonzalez as its 2017-18 editor-in-chief. She replaces outgoing editor-in-chief, Kathryn Pfefferle.
The student-run journal, published twice a year, is one of the earliest in the nation devoted to the study of gender and the law. It includes articles by students and legal professionals, and also sponsors an annual symposium.
Other board members for 2017-18 include:
- Alex Abernethy, senior Note and Comment editor
- Morgan Stippel and Michelle Saney, senior managing articles editors
- Paisley Hoffman, senior submissions editor
- Annie Getsinger, Symposium editor
- Dana Roth, business editor
